summ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orGonzalo Exequiel Pedone2024-03-25 18:31:21 -0300
committerGonzalo Exequiel Pedone2024-03-25 18:31:21 -0300
commitdac9ff1465cf01d8c8c0235ff7459cb2ebce33fa (patch)
tree51d9df76a53074e2b48c5f4f099e05d2835844f6
parent198a3144224c6835ebde3d9cd6d86792f1c1926c (diff)
downloadaur-dac9ff1465cf01d8c8c0235ff7459cb2ebce33fa.tar.gz
Build library only.
-rw-r--r--.SRCINFO4
-rw-r--r--PKGBUILD8
2 files changed, 7 insertions, 5 deletions
diff --git a/.SRCINFO b/.SRCINFO
index d9fd9ecaf20b..4bd9b78c723e 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,7 +1,7 @@
pkgbase = android-x86-64-libnghttp3
- pkgdesc = HTTP/3 library written in C (android)
+ pkgdesc = HTTP/3 library written in C (Android x86-64)
pkgver = 1.2.0
- pkgrel = 1
+ pkgrel = 2
url = https://github.com/ngtcp2/nghttp3
arch = any
license = MIT
diff --git a/PKGBUILD b/PKGBUILD
index f5b2b340ca13..709866a7fc6e 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-6,9 +6,9 @@ _android_arch=x86-64
pkgname=android-${_android_arch}-libnghttp3
pkgver=1.2.0
-pkgrel=1
+pkgrel=2
arch=('any')
-pkgdesc='HTTP/3 library written in C (android)'
+pkgdesc="HTTP/3 library written in C (Android ${_android_arch})"
url='https://github.com/ngtcp2/nghttp3'
license=('MIT')
depends=('android-ndk')
@@ -30,7 +30,8 @@ build() {
cd "${srcdir}/nghttp3-$pkgver"
source android-env ${_android_arch}
- android-${_android_arch}-configure
+ android-${_android_arch}-configure \
+ --enable-lib-only
make $MAKEFLAGS
}
@@ -39,6 +40,7 @@ package() {
source android-env ${_android_arch}
make DESTDIR="$pkgdir" install
+ rm -rf "$pkgdir/${ANDROID_PREFIX_SHARE}"
${ANDROID_STRIP} -g --strip-unneeded "${pkgdir}"/${ANDROID_PREFIX_LIB}/*.so
${ANDROID_STRIP} -g "$pkgdir"/${ANDROID_PREFIX_LIB}/*.a
}